Suburb Overview

Bective is a regional centre in New South Wales, Australia, with a population of approximately 194, making it a boutique locality. Located approximately 322 km from the Sydney CBD, Bective is a regional area in New South Wales. The median household income is $81,900 per year.

Investment Insight

Bective is a smaller community of 194 — about 4% of the New South Wales suburb median (5,325) — so investors should factor in the narrower buyer pool and longer average time-on-market. Household income of $81,900/year is 16% below the New South Wales median of $97,552, typically translating into lower entry prices and a tenant base more sensitive to rent increases. Median rent of $305/week (~$1,322/month) covers only 61% of the median mortgage of $2,167/month — the remaining $845/month must be funded from other income, so this suburb tilts toward capital growth rather than yield. Bective is 322 km from Sydney, so the local market tracks regional employment and lifestyle drivers more than CBD-driven commuter demand. Separate houses make up 93% of dwellings — 17 percentage points above the New South Wales median of 76% — pointing to a family-oriented, land-rich market where value is concentrated in the underlying block.
